What Are Custom Abutments?
Think of a custom abutment as the precision-engineered connection between a dental implant and its final crown. It’s not just a simple connector; it’s a component designed specifically for each patient’s unique anatomy. Using advanced computer-aided design and manufacturing (CAD/CAM) technology, these abutments are milled to exact specifications, ensuring the final restoration fits perfectly and looks completely natural. This patient-specific approach moves beyond the one-size-fits-all model, laying the groundwork for a more stable, aesthetic, and durable implant restoration. By creating a seamless transition from the implant to the crown, a custom abutment supports both the hard and soft tissues, which is essential for achieving predictable, high-quality results that stand the test of time.
Custom vs. Stock: The Key Differences
Stock abutments are the "off-the-shelf" option. They are pre-made in standard sizes and can be a quick, cost-effective choice for straightforward cases, particularly in the posterior region. However, their standardized shape often requires compromises in fit and aesthetics. Custom abutments, on the other hand, are designed from the ground up for each individual. They are crafted to match the patient’s specific gingival contours and the ideal position of the final crown. This tailored approach results in a much more accurate and natural-looking outcome, especially for anterior teeth where aesthetics are paramount.
The Abutment's Role in Implant Success
The abutment does more than just connect parts; it plays a foundational role in the long-term health and success of the implant. A well-designed custom abutment helps shape the surrounding gum tissue, creating a natural emergence profile that makes the final crown look like a real tooth. This precise fit also helps establish a healthy seal at the gum line, protecting the implant from bacteria. Furthermore, custom abutments are designed to place the crown margin at an ideal depth, which simplifies the process of cleaning up excess cement after delivery. This small detail is critical for preventing peri-implantitis and ensuring the longevity of the restoration.

Promote Better Gum Health
Maintaining long-term peri-implant health is a top priority, and custom abutments play a crucial role in achieving it. Their primary advantage here is the ability to control the margin placement of the final restoration. You can design the abutment to place the crown margin at or just below the gingival level, making it much easier to completely remove excess cement after seating the crown. As you know, retained cement is a leading cause of peri-implant inflammation and bone loss. By designing for easier cement removal, you significantly reduce the risk of future complications and support the long-term health of the surrounding soft tissue, setting your patients up for lasting success.

What Are Custom Abutments Made Of?
The material you choose for a custom abutment is one of the most critical decisions in the implant process, directly impacting the restoration's strength, longevity, and appearance. While stock abutments offer limited options, custom abutments open the door to materials selected specifically for your patient’s unique clinical and aesthetic needs. The two leading materials in modern implant dentistry are titanium and zirconia, each with a distinct set of properties that make them suitable for different applications.
Understanding the characteristics of each material allows you to tailor every restoration with precision. Titanium has long been the industry standard due to its incredible strength and proven biocompatibility. Zirconia, on the other hand, has become a popular choice for its superior aesthetics, especially in cases where the final look is the top priority. The decision isn't always about which material is "better" overall, but which is the right choice for the specific case in your chair. By weighing factors like implant location, gum tissue thickness, and functional demands, you can confidently select a material that ensures a stable, healthy, and beautiful outcome for your patient.
Titanium Abutments
Titanium is a powerhouse material in implant dentistry, and for good reason. It’s known for its exceptional strength and durability, making it more than capable of withstanding the heavy occlusal forces in the posterior region. Its most significant advantage, however, is its proven biocompatibility. The body accepts titanium extremely well, allowing for excellent osseointegration and minimizing the risk of adverse tissue reactions. This material is also highly resistant to corrosion, ensuring the abutment remains stable and reliable for years. For cases where strength and long-term function are the primary concerns, titanium remains the go-to choice for clinicians worldwide.
Zirconia Abutments
When aesthetics are non-negotiable, zirconia is the clear winner. This ceramic material is prized for its tooth-like color and translucency, which prevents the dark, metallic line that can sometimes appear at the gumline with titanium abutments, especially in patients with thin gingival biotypes. Zirconia’s aesthetic qualities make it the ideal choice for anterior restorations where a natural, seamless blend with the surrounding teeth is essential. While it excels in appearance, modern zirconia is also incredibly strong and resistant to fracture, offering a reliable combination of beauty and function that meets the demands of today’s patients.
How to Choose the Right Material
Selecting the right material involves a careful assessment of each patient's individual needs. There’s no one-size-fits-all answer; the decision requires balancing functional demands with aesthetic goals. When making your choice, you’ll need to comprehensively consider several key factors. For posterior implants that handle heavy chewing forces, titanium’s superior strength is often the safest bet. For anterior implants in the "smile zone," zirconia is typically preferred to achieve the most natural-looking result. You should also evaluate the patient’s gum tissue thickness and the depth of the implant placement, as these factors can influence the final aesthetic outcome.

The Digital Workflow: Scanning and Design
Everything starts with a highly accurate digital picture of the patient's mouth. Custom abutments are created through a digital workflow that begins with precise scanning of the patient's oral anatomy. This digital impression is the foundation for the entire process, capturing every detail of the implant site and surrounding tissues without the need for messy traditional impression materials. This data is then loaded into design software, where a skilled technician can meticulously craft the abutment. They can adjust the emergence profile for ideal tissue support, place margins exactly where they need to be for easy cement cleanup, and correct implant angulation for a perfect prosthetic fit. The result is a detailed, personalized blueprint for an abutment that’s made just for your patient.
Precision Manufacturing with CAD/CAM Technology
Once the digital design is finalized, it’s time to bring it into the physical world. This is where CAD/CAM technology comes in. The finalized design file is sent to a sophisticated milling machine that fabricates the abutment from a solid block of high-quality material, like titanium or zirconia. The use of CAD/CAM technology in manufacturing ensures incredible precision and consistency from one abutment to the next. This automated process translates the digital blueprint into a physical component with microscopic accuracy, eliminating the potential for human error. The result is an abutment that not only fits the implant and surrounding tissue perfectly but also supports the final restoration for exceptional aesthetic and functional outcomes.

Problems with Fit and Aesthetics
The primary issue with stock abutments is their lack of customization. Because they are prefabricated in standard sizes and shapes, achieving a natural-looking result is often a matter of chance. This is especially true for anterior restorations where aesthetics are paramount. An ill-fitting stock abutment can result in an improper emergence profile, leading to a crown that looks bulky or unnatural at the gumline. The standardized shape may not properly support the surrounding soft tissue, causing discoloration or an unappealing transition from the implant to the crown. For front teeth, this can be the difference between a confident smile and a restoration the patient is always trying to hide.
Risks to Gum Health
A poor fit doesn't just impact aesthetics; it poses a significant risk to your patient's periodontal health. When a stock abutment doesn't align perfectly with the gum tissue, it can be difficult to place the crown correctly. This can create ledges or open margins where plaque and bacteria accumulate, leading to chronic gum inflammation and, in severe cases, bone loss around the implant. Furthermore, excess cement left behind from cementing the crown can be a major irritant. With a stock abutment, the margin is often placed deep below the gums, making complete cement removal nearly impossible and setting the stage for future complications like peri-implantitis.

Difficulties with Adjustments in Complex Cases
In straightforward cases, you might be able to make a stock abutment work with some effort. However, for complex situations, they are rarely a viable option. Cases involving angled implants, deep implant placement, or uneven soft tissue contours demand a level of precision that stock components simply cannot provide. Trying to force a prefabricated part to fit these unique scenarios often leads to a compromised outcome. You may struggle to achieve proper occlusion, create a passive fit for the crown, or meet the patient's aesthetic expectations. In these instances, a custom abutment isn't just a better choice—it's the only way to ensure a predictable, stable, and successful result.

Understanding the Cost Factors
The price of a custom abutment can vary, but they generally fall in the range of $300 per unit. The final cost depends on the material—such as titanium or zirconia—the case's complexity, and your lab partner's fees. One of the best ways to manage costs is by embracing a digital workflow. Many labs offer a reduced price for digital file submissions, streamlining the implant restoration process from the start. This approach not only makes it more affordable but also enhances precision, giving you a predictable outcome.

What's the most important factor when choosing between a titanium and a zirconia abutment? The decision really comes down to balancing strength with aesthetics for each specific case. For posterior teeth that handle heavy chewing forces, titanium’s proven strength and durability make it the most reliable choice. For anterior teeth in the smile line, zirconia is often preferred because its tooth-like color prevents any gray metal from showing through thin gum tissue, resulting in a more natural and beautiful final look.
